S’more Cheese Ball
Marshmallows, chocolate and graham crackers combine to make one delicious sweet cheese ball. It is everything you love about s’mores wrapped up into on tasty dessert appetizer!

- 16 ounces cream cheese, softened
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- 1 cup mini marshmallows
- ½ cup marshmallow crème
- 1 cup mini chocolate chips
- ½ cup graham cracker crumbs
- ¼ mini chocolate chips
- ¼ cup marshmallow bits
- In medium bowl combine cream cheese, powdered sugar, mini marshmallows, marshmallow creme and 1 cup mini chocolate chips. Beat until well combined.
- Form soft ball and place in a container for 10 minutes in the freezer.
- While cheese ball is setting, combine graham crackers, chocolate chips and marshmallow bits on a large plate and mix.
- Remove cheese ball and roll in graham cracker mixture.
- Refrigerate for it least ½ hour and server with graham crackers.

Where does one get marshmallow bits for the outer coating? I don't recall seeing these in a bakery ingredient aisle before. :)
Chef in Training
I find them next to the marshmallows at Target. They come in a canister. Hope that helps :) They are like the marshmallows in hot cocoa .
